LGA seeks tighter rules for fixed caravan parks

Council chiefs have called on the Government to tighten the laws regarding fixed caravan sites.

The Local Government Association (LGA) has written to housing minister, Grant Shapps, urging him to adjust licensing laws and make park home-owners pay costs which come with meeting legal requirements.
